Clover not a choice for retail, very misrepresented and pricey
Revisado el 22/9/2016
Puntos a favor
There is absolutely nothing that I like about this product except maybe the appearance and not too bad adding in stock that is already in the system.
Puntos en contra
This is marketed as a state of the art POS system with added capabilities through apps. However the base system is so limited that i would not even consider it a POS system, but more of an expensive payment processor. I had researched retail systems and most have lots of features and capabilities such as accepting unlimited bar codes, include a wide variety of detailed reports, inventory management including tracking of stock, re-orders, keeping track of back orders, client records, all kinds of very basic needs to a retail store. When the bank presented this system, I asked very specifically about its capabilities and gave very clear information on what I needed in a system. The rep assured me that it not only did all of the basics that I needed, but it also had apps that were available for customizing and expanding , such as going into also having an online sales presence. So, I feel it was either deliberately misrepresented or the rep is not trained at all on what the system offers and did not feel it important enough to get valid answers. The basic system does not even include basic necessary functions for retail. 1) it has a 15,000 bar code limit, plus other limits for categories and modifiers. - Their solution is for you to create new bar codes per item and just use the modifiers and what not to make up for it - however the modifiers and such also have limits. 2) it does not allow more than one wholesale cost per bar code. So if you obtain stock at differing prices due to seasons, volume, clearance, or price increases - the new prices over writes the original price put in. There is no way to have different cost for the same item. So again their suggestion is creating new bar codes for new pricing or to have a separate system for tracking cost of goods. 3) The reports are nominal. They look like ticker tape reports. No report gives information usable for a purchase order. I made the categories my suppliers so I could easily use the category report to reorder sold products, but the product and bar codes are not part of the report, so the only indicator of which item it is is the description and price. There are also few types of reports available compared to other systems I had looked at. 4) There is no purchase order capability in the base system, so also no way to track orders, back orders or way to easily know what to even order from sales or stock quantities. 5) I have had multiple times where items are put into inventory only to have them not show up when scanned at the register. Part of the time, I will go into the inventory app later and find the item with all of the necessary info there, but for some reason it is not getting picked up by the register app. Other times it isn't there and even after going back and re-entering again, I still have same problem, so I have resorted to running these items as a customer item which has further screwed up the accuracy of my inventory. 6) Due to various glitches (items not showing up in or possibly not even being subtracted properly from inventory) my inventory is nowhere close to accurate and at some point will have to be fixed. 7) To order or check inventory has to be done almost exclusively by physically going through my store to see what truly is in the store and what is needed and then typing up an order or report from that. 8) new inventory is all added manually rather than the scanner adding into the inventory app. So if you have two on the shelf, but two more you add it to make now 4. There is nothing that shows you who or what manually added or subtracted from the inventory app or when. You can assign specific access to specific functions, but I have found no oversight at all, there is no way to see what they are actually doing besides their name by the transaction they oversaw at the register. This is only the beginning of what this system lacks. 9) The only way to make up for these shortfalls is through the app store (which they had told me was for customizing, expansive needs - not basic functions). I still have yet to see anything that really covers everything this system lacks and each app costs monthly and I could easily be spending somewhere between $99 and $250/ month on an app - and its a thrid party app, that though approved, is not guaranteed, and then it is more customer service reps to deal with. I have been unable to get any decent or helpful responses from customer service reps just with the system itself - can't imagine what it would be like with glitches between apps and the system.On top of all of what the system does not do, I got mine though a lease which is way more expensive then it was presented to be, and the lease is "iron clad, unbreakable" with no guarantee the system works for my situation. I have taken it to corporate level and the best I have gotten so far is an apology that I have been inconvenienced but still denying me the ability to get out of the lease. This is so non-functional for a dance store with lots of shoes, that I will have to get another system while paying for this one while I fight to get it resolved. The only reason I leased this system was the answers given to me bto very thorough questions and it was 100% misrepresented. I hate dealing with tech anything by phone and it looked like a simple solution - on the ground set up and my bank, merchant services, POS all basically through the same place. What a disaster it has been. Has made everything more time consuming then if I had just had a basic old fashioned register and done books handwritten and not had to spend so much. The purpose of the point of sale system was to simplify book keeping and have all of the inventory, purchase orders, client info, etc. all in one system. This does absolutely nothing well except possibly process the payments - at what is seeming like pretty high fees.

Overpriced, poor customer service
Revisado el 16/1/2020
I wouldn't recommend Clover to any business owner. We tested it out for about a month and are not...
I wouldn't recommend Clover to any business owner. We tested it out for about a month and are not able to access reports that we need - they disappeared with no notice - and the customer service is horrific. They just keep sending me links to their website, but not helping get the reports. And they are really rude. The reason we decided against Clover is because every little thing you need as a business owner is additional money - to get it to talk to any of your accounting software, to have a mailing list, etc.- and it just doesn't do what you need. You can't have tax included in your price, only add on to it. You can't give a 100% discount on a ticket without it charging tax on the original cost (who charges tax on $0.00?). The iPhone app to see reporting for what's happening when you're away from your business is incredibly clunky. Overall it's a terrible user experience. There are loads of better options out there.
Puntos a favor
Honestly, we really didn't like anything about Clover from the start - we hoped we would get used to it + like it, but it's pretty terrible.
Puntos en contra
Inability to include tax with the price, poor UX on the mobile dashboard app, terrible customer service, third-party apps to connect to accounting software are expensive and don't always deliver, high price for low value.

Not for Retailers
Revisado el 23/11/2020
The problems come with the back office.
The inventory system is basic to say the least, items sold...
The problems come with the back office.
The inventory system is basic to say the least, items sold at the till do decrease the totals, but all purchase quatities have to be done manually, you cannot set min and max stock levels, or re-order levels with the bundled system, so re-orders have to have a physical stock check, I am still trying to work out how this saves me time and money.
Clover relies heavily on thrid party APPs, which they absolve themselves of all responsibility in their T's & C's. These Apps are expensive
(The Shopventory APP is £40 Pm +VAT)
The E-Commerce integration does not work.
The Magento integration is for Magento 1m which was made obsolete in June 2018, and is no longer supported.
The Shopify integration does not work either, and for me failed at the first hurdle, (I have now been waiting 14 days for a fix).
I purchased a barcode reader they recommended, not even their support staff could get it to work, I was promised a fix, five months ago.
In my opinon this system out of the box is not for retail, unless you want to see your profits dwindle through the purchase of expensive APP's.
The actual helpdesk staff are very helpful, but they can only do so much.
The actual management are a nightmare to deal with.
I first presented some of these issues within 30 days and was promised a fix, five months later I am being told that even though I registered those issues it will cost me over £1500 to get out of a 48 month contract.
Puntos a favor
The till itself is fantastic, it looks ultra sleek and ultra modern, customers love it.
And that is about it
Puntos en contra
It was sold to me as a solution to me retail needs it certainly is not

Great but has limitations
Revisado el 8/4/2022
Overall, it’s been really great. Whenever we have issues, clover is usually able to solve it. Their...
Overall, it’s been really great. Whenever we have issues, clover is usually able to solve it. Their customer service has been wonderful; they take time to understand issues and make notes for their software engineers when there’s a bug.
Puntos a favor
Easy to use; intuitive layout.
The report overview can show sales by-the-hour which is helpful for planning.
The add-on apps have been working well; Menufy & the inventory audit are great.
The inventory audit add on also has a downloadable app which has significantly streamlined our inventory process.
Great customer service-they are able and willing to help fix any issues that come up.
Puntos en contra
The hardware can be glitchy. 2 examples: (1) the station will start clicking buttons randomly and sometimes this can only be stopped by restarting the machine. (2) the biometric finger print sign in will crash about 50% of the time when trying to add new employees.
The reports could be more customizable and the filters could be more detailed.
It would be nice if the whole thing was able to be customized to fit our unique needs, but for the price it works well enough.
